Detailed Course Content

The Greek and Roman epigraphy in their historical development. During the lessons will be read and commented Greek inscriptions from the Archaic to Hellenistic period, and then Roman inscriptions, from VII century BC to Late Imperial period. Photocopies of the texts will be distributed and a Power Point will be uploaded.


Textbook Information

- A. Geoffrey Woodhead, The Study of Greek Inscriptions, Cambridge, 1967, pp. 139.

- A.E. Cooley, The Cambridge Manual of Latin Epigraphy, Cambridge.N.Y. 2012, pp. 554.
